>Can i do one of them safari tours in a weekend? It would be pretty cool but i'm only planning on staying 2 days.
That's a tight schedule but I'm certain you can. I chose a company called Viva Safaris. You tell them how many days you want and they will shuttle you to and from joburg and everywhere in between (different camp sites). I stayed in an open preserve (private property that is literally open to kruger national park so any wild life can wander in). Then the guides took us in an open air vehicle through kruger park (very well kept highways running through it. There was a massive gated rest stop in the middle of the park with restaurants). Staff and accommodations were excellent. It's not a five star hotel, but the beds were comfortable and clean. Had 5g everywhere but deep into kruger.
